Follow in the footsteps of the famous African Congo explorers Henry Stanley and David Livingston at the jungle-themed Congo River Miniature Golf.
Course greens are moderately difficult, with plenty of caves, shafts, and hills to require a few mulligans - should your party allow it! The International Drive and Kissimmee locations offer two different 18-hole courses to choose from - the Livingston is by far the most challenging of the two.
The decor includes a "crashed" zebra-striped cargo plane, abandoned congo river boats, rock formations, waterfalls, and plenty of "jungle" decorations, which means palms and carved tiki faces. Small, plastic putters are available for toddlers, and older family members can choose from regular putters in multiple sizes.
A smallish arcade offers a few electronic games, and air hockey at some locations. Kids can even feed the live alligators surrounding the mini-golf complex. Families can also play the exploration game on the back of the scorecard. Discover the listed treasures and turn in the card at the end of your game to receive a Congo River Exploration Prize.
Birthday Parties: Parties at all locations include one round (18 holes) of golf, a free novelty golf ball for the birthday child, use of party space - either picnic tables or party room, and arcade game tokens. Food, drinks, and decorations can be brought into the complex, or each location has a list of pizza places that deliver. Each location also offers additional items and add ons.
